Kijimadaira Hotel & Travel Guide\n
Planning to visit Nagano? Desire somewhere to put your feet up? Travelocity's booking portal has a wide range of options. Modern travelers using Travelocity can research about 16 great hotels and apartments within convenient driving distance from Kijimadaira's main area.
Located within a manageable drive of Kijimadaira, are the Nozawa Grand Hotel and Kawamotoya.
Check out the Jinpyokaku and also the Issano Komichi Biyuno Yado. The Jinpyokaku is situated just 8 miles (13 kilometers) outside of the heart of Kijimadaira. The Issano Komichi Biyuno Yado, is located 8 miles (12 kilometers) away. Other accommodation options include the Shiga Park Hotel and the Kusatsu Now Resort Hotel.
The broader Chubu region is worth exploring too. Explore Chubu's ruins. Those drawn to nature should also put aside some time to admire its beaches, mountains and active volcanos. Intrepid visitors may also get involved in snowboarding, skiing and cross-country skiing here.
On the hunt for things to do? Consider spending a few hours exploring Happo-one Adam Gondola and Hakuba Green Sports Park, in Hakuba, 35 miles (56 kilometers) to the west of Kijimadaira. When you stay in Hakuba, check out the Gakuto Villas and Hakuba Tokyu Hotel. Or, stay the night in Hakuba, 35 miles (59 kilometers) west of Kijimadaira, where you can choose between the Hakuba Mominoki Hotel and Hakuba Onsen Ryokan Shirouma-so. The Hakuba 47 Winter Sports Park and Hakuba Happoone Ski Area are popular sites to explore when in Hakuba.
Before you head home from Nagano, be sure you are able to watch some fast-paced sport. Swing by Nagano Olympic Stadium, to the southwest of Kijimadaira. Modern travelers who enjoy the ease of staying nearby, book a room in the Hotel Route-Inn Court Shinonoi or Shinshu-Matsushiro Royal Hotel.
When you choose to fly to Kijimadaira, Toyama Airport is your most convenient airport. It's 70 miles (116 kilometers) from downtown. Hotel Route-Inn Toyama Inter is a nearby hotel.
